This song has hundreds of iterations, and possibly originates from "The Unfortunate Rake" in Victorian London. Whatever, it is a happy little ditty about a young man and his lady dying from an STD. For this version, it was suggested that I base it on the Doc Watson version, but, I do prefer to make my own arrangements.

I'm playing me 1964 Martin D12-20 rebuilt by Martin in 1998 with a D12-35 trim, and adjustable truss rod - something of a one off. However, like all good 12 strings and Martins it is incredibly challenging to keep in tune. The D'addario Capo - courtesy of my friend - "Sir Robin of Wales". I use D'addario EJ37 strings (12/12 - 54/30) tuned down one tone.
